Kinco 1927KW: Best Cold Weather Farm Glove
Heavy-duty pigskin leather makes this glove a staple for any property owner facing a harsh winter. Pigskin is naturally more breathable than cowhide and, crucially, it remains soft and pliable even after being soaked and dried. This resilience prevents the “cardboard” feel that often ruins lesser leather gloves after a snowy morning of feeding.
The HeatKeep thermal lining utilizes polyester fibers to trap air and create a warm microclimate around the fingers. It excels at insulating against the bite of freezing metal tools or cold wooden handles. While the insulation adds some bulk, it provides enough flexibility to grip a shovel or carry heavy buckets without fighting the glove’s structure.
The knit wrist is a small but vital detail for farm work, as it creates a snug seal that prevents hay chaff and snow from sliding down into the palm. This feature is particularly helpful when tossing bales or clearing brush where debris is constantly flying. The reinforced leather patches on the palm and fingers offer extra protection in high-wear areas.
Choose the Kinco 1927KW if the primary concern is surviving long hours in sub-freezing temperatures while performing rugged manual labor. These are not intended for fine-motor tasks like sorting seeds, but they are nearly indestructible for fencing, hauling, and wood-splitting. They are the definitive choice for a reliable, warm workhorse that lasts multiple seasons.
Wells Lamont HydraHyde: Best Wet Weather Pick
Working in the rain or handling wet livestock requires a glove that won’t turn into a soggy mess within minutes. The HydraHyde technology involves a specialized tanning process that makes the leather water-resistant and breathable for the life of the product. Unlike topical sprays that wear off, this protection is integrated directly into the cowhide fibers.
These gloves feature a fleece lining that provides moderate warmth, making them ideal for the chilly, damp transitions of spring and autumn. The leather remains remarkably supple, allowing for a firm grip on slippery surfaces like wet PVC pipes or muddy gate latches. They bridge the gap between a summer work glove and a heavy winter mitt.
The keystone thumb design improves the overall fit and allows for a more natural range of motion. This reduces hand fatigue during repetitive tasks like milking or hand-tool weeding in damp soil. The elasticized wrist helps keep the glove in place while providing a quick on-and-off capability for moving between the barn and the house.
If the local climate involves more mud and sleet than dry snow, the Wells Lamont HydraHyde is the superior option. It provides the durability of traditional leather without the liability of water absorption. This is the glove for the farmer who refuses to let a week of heavy rain stall their outdoor productivity.
Carhartt A513: Best Choice for High Dexterity
Precision tasks on a hobby farm, such as repairing a drip irrigation system or adjusting a carburetor, require a glove that acts like a second skin. The Carhartt A513 utilizes a synthetic suede palm that offers excellent tactile feedback. You can actually feel the threads of a bolt or the tension of a wire, which is impossible in thicker insulated models.
The back of the hand is constructed from a breathable, padded spandex material that protects against scrapes while allowing heat to escape. This prevents the “swamp hand” effect during high-intensity chores in mild weather. A reinforced thumb and saddle area ensure that the glove doesn’t blow out at the most common points of stress.
A secure hook-and-loop closure at the wrist allows for a customized fit that won’t shift during use. This is essential for safety when working around moving parts or power tools where a loose glove could become a hazard. The sleek profile also means these gloves can easily slide into a pocket when not in use.
The Carhartt A513 is the right pick for those who prioritize agility and feel over raw insulation. It is a specialized tool for mechanical work, light gardening, and hardware installation. If the day involves more screwdrivers than sledgehammers, this glove will be the most comfortable and effective choice.
Showa Atlas 370: Best Lightweight Chore Glove
Summer on a small farm often involves messy, repetitive tasks that don’t require heavy leather but do require a barrier against dirt and thorns. The Showa Atlas 370 features a thin, nitrile-coated palm on a seamless knit liner. It is incredibly lightweight and provides a “sticky” grip that is perfect for handling smooth plastic trays or wet plant starts.
The uncoated back allows for maximum airflow, making these the most comfortable option for weeding or harvesting in the heat of July. Because they are thin, they offer unparalleled dexterity for picking berries or thinning seedlings. They are also remarkably durable for their weight, resisting punctures from rose thorns and brambles.
One of the greatest advantages of these gloves is their low cost and ease of maintenance. They are inexpensive enough to keep a dozen pairs on hand, ensuring there is always a dry set available. When they get caked in mud, simply toss them in the washing machine and air dry them for the next day’s work.
These are the essential daily-use gloves for the gardening season and light barn chores. They are not suited for heavy masonry or dragging heavy logs, but for nearly everything else, they are the most practical solution. Ironclad Tundra: Best for Extreme Winter Work
When the temperature drops well below zero and the wind is howling, standard work gloves simply fail. The Ironclad Tundra is engineered for these extreme conditions, featuring a multi-layer insulation system and a 100% waterproof insert. It is designed to keep hands functional when the environment is actively trying to shut them down.
The glove includes an integrated armor system on the knuckles and fingers to protect against impacts in freezing weather, when skin is most brittle and prone to injury. A gauntlet-style cuff with a pull-cinch fits easily over a heavy winter coat, creating a total seal against drifting snow. This is the heavy armor of the glove world.
Despite the heavy insulation, the palm features a reinforced grip material that stays tacky in the cold. This is crucial for safely operating a snowblower or hauling heavy frozen water buckets. The goatskin leather reinforcements add durability without the extreme stiffness found in lower-quality extreme-weather gear.
The Ironclad Tundra is for the farmer who must face the worst of winter head-on. If chores include breaking thick ice, clearing heavy snow, or operating machinery in sub-zero winds, these are a necessary investment. They are bulky, but the trade-off is absolute protection against frostbite and injury.
Mechanix Wear Durahide: Best All-Season Option
Finding a single glove that handles 70% of farm tasks year-round is the “holy grail” of work gear. The Mechanix Wear Durahide utilizes a proprietary leather that is exceptionally resistant to abrasion while remaining thin enough for versatile use. It combines the protective qualities of a traditional leather glove with the ergonomic design of a high-performance sports glove.
The stretch-elastic cuffs provide a secure fit that is easy to pull on when the goats get loose or the mail arrives. The palm construction removes unnecessary material to reduce bunching, which is a common complaint with traditional “driver” style gloves. This leads to better control when using hand tools like pruners or hammers.
Because they lack heavy liners, they are comfortable in the spring and fall, and can even be used in the summer for heavy-duty tasks like moving stone or stacking firewood. In the winter, they function well for quick chores where dexterity is still needed. They are the definition of a versatile, “grab-and-go” farm accessory.
Choose the Mechanix Wear Durahide if you want a reliable, high-quality glove that doesn’t need to be swapped out every hour. It is the best choice for the hobby farmer who wants one dependable pair for fencing, light construction, and general property maintenance. It is a professional-grade tool that respects the wearer’s need for both toughness and touch.
Key Features to Consider in All-Weather Gloves
The primary material of a glove dictates its lifespan and specific utility on the farm. Cowhide is the standard for abrasion resistance and is excellent for heavy-duty tasks like hauling lumber or handling barbed wire. Goatskin is thinner and softer, providing a better balance of protection and dexterity, while Pigskin is the undisputed king of wet-weather leather due to its ability to stay soft after drying.
Insulation types are equally important and should be matched to the local climate. Thinsulate is a popular synthetic choice because it provides warmth without excessive bulk, making it easier to move fingers. Fleece is softer and provides immediate comfort but can lose its insulating properties if it becomes saturated with sweat or water. Unlined gloves are strictly for warm weather or high-dexterity mechanical tasks where any barrier between the hand and the tool is a hindrance.
The cuff design is a frequently overlooked feature that can make or break a glove’s effectiveness. * Knit wrists keep debris out and provide warmth. * Safety cuffs are wide and stiff, allowing the wearer to flick the glove off quickly if it gets caught in machinery. * Gauntlet cuffs offer the most protection against snow and wind but can be cumbersome. * Hook-and-loop closures provide the most secure, adjustable fit for precision work.
How to Find the Perfect Fit for Working Hands
A glove that is too tight will restrict blood flow, causing hands to feel colder and tire faster during chores. Conversely, a glove that is too loose will cause chafing and blisters, and the extra material at the fingertips can become a dangerous snag hazard. To find the right size, measure the circumference of the palm just below the knuckles; most manufacturers provide a sizing chart based on this measurement.
Pay close attention to finger length, as this is where most fit issues occur. There should be no more than a quarter-inch of space at the tip of the fingers. If the fingers are too long, tasks like picking up a dropped screw or opening a gate latch become frustratingly difficult. If they are too short, the webbing between the fingers will be under constant tension, leading to premature glove failure.
Leather gloves will almost always have a break-in period. They should feel “snug but not restrictive” when brand new. Over the first few hours of use, the leather will stretch and mold to the specific contours of the hand. Synthetic gloves generally do not stretch, so the fit they provide out of the box is how they will remain for their entire lifespan.
Cleaning and Maintaining Leather and Nitrile
Proper maintenance can double the life of a high-quality pair of leather gloves. Never dry wet leather gloves over a direct heat source like a wood stove or a radiator, as this will bake the natural oils out of the hide and cause it to crack. Instead, allow them to air dry slowly at room temperature, ideally on a boot dryer that uses low-pressure, ambient air.
For dirty leather, use a damp cloth and a small amount of saddle soap to remove grit and salt. Once clean and dry, applying a leather conditioner or “mink oil” will restore the suppleness and improve water resistance. This is particularly important for cowhide gloves, which tend to stiffen more than pigskin or goatskin after repeated exposure to the elements.
Synthetic and nitrile-coated gloves are much simpler to maintain but still require care. Most can be machine-washed on a gentle cycle with cold water, which removes the salts from sweat that can degrade the fabric. Avoid using a dryer for nitrile gloves, as high heat can cause the rubberized coating to become brittle and peel away from the knit liner.
Managing Hand Temperature Across Four Seasons
Controlling hand temperature is a matter of moisture management as much as it is insulation. Sweat is the enemy of warmth in the winter; once the interior of a glove becomes damp from perspiration, the evaporative cooling will quickly lead to chilled fingers. If performing high-effort tasks in the cold, it is often better to use a medium-weight glove and switch to a heavy insulated pair only when the activity level drops.
Layering is an effective strategy for extreme or unpredictable weather. A thin silk or synthetic liner glove can be worn inside a larger unlined leather glove. This provides a modular system where the outer shell can be removed for delicate tasks while still keeping the skin protected from the biting wind. This approach is highly effective for morning chores that start in the freezing dark and end in the warmer sun.
In the heat of summer, prioritize breathability above all else. Hand fatigue often stems from the discomfort of overheating, which leads to a loss of grip and focus. Using a glove with a mesh or spandex back allows the body’s natural cooling system to work, keeping the farmer more comfortable and productive during the long days of the growing season.
